79741
79741 is a odd composite number that follows 79740 and precedes 79742. It is composed of 4 distinct factors: 1, 23, 3467, 79741. Its prime factorization can be written as 23 × 3467. 79741 is classified as a deficient number based on the sum of its proper divisors. In computer science, 79741 is represented as 10011011101111101 in binary and 1377D in hexadecimal.
